Frequently asked questions on the trip Cancún - Tulum
What is the travel distance from Cancún to Tulum?
The distance between Cancún and Tulum is around 129 km (80 miles).
What are the departure and arrival locations for buses traveling from Cancún to Tulum?
Buses traveling this route start their trip at Cancun Airport, in Cancún, and end it at ADO Bus Terminal - Tulum Ruins, in Tulum.

Buses are energy-efficient. Carrying a passenger over 100 kms by coach only takes 0.6-0.9 liters of gas. Compare that to the 2.6 liters required by high-speed train, 6.6 liters by airplane and 7.6 liters by gas-powered car, and it's clear that the bus is a more environmentally-conscious option for your bus transportation from Cancún to Tulum.
